
Electrolysis Testbench EL1 - M
Maximum Precision & Durability for Your Electrolysis Testing
The GFS Testbench EL1 is the perfect solution for accurate and long-term stable testing in electrolysis research. Designed for PEM, AEM, and AEL electrolysis cells, it accommodates cell areas from 1 to 100 cm² and supports both atmospheric and pressurized operation up to 50 bar.

Technical Data
Max. Current
180A / 320 A
Measuerement Accuracy
± 0.1 mV
Media Heating
up to 90°C
Control
manual & autonomous
Data Evaluation
graphical data analysis
Max. Voltage
Up to 12 V
Liquid Media Flow
up to 5 l/min
Software
GFS CellFlow
Pressure
up to 50 bar
Compatibilty
numerous 3rd party devices
